- [ ] Step 7: Archive cold storage buckets (Glacierline tier). Confirm both ceremony witnesses are present, verify bucket manifests match the Oxbow ledger, then seal the archive key shares. Plugin authors may observe but not handle shares. Once sealed, the archive index itself is encrypted and can only be reopened with the passphrase below.

vault phrase of badup-hahig = tamael-aldael-kelmir-istael-fenok-istwyn-tamius-jorath-oliion

**Ticket #4312 — Garage occupancy feed stuck at 100%**

Hey folks — welcome to the ParkPulse team! Quick one for whoever picks this up: the occupancy feed for the Larkmoor Street garage has been reporting full since Tuesday, even though the sensors on level 2 show plenty of open spots. Looks like the aggregator job in SpotSync isn't clearing stale counts when a sensor reconnects. Check the rollup worker first before digging into firmware. The offending run's trace token is pasted below so you can pull logs fast.

pipeline stamp: htk6_35e0c9

The garage occupancy feed for the Brindlewood campus arrives over a message queue every thirty seconds, one record per level, published by the Stallgrid edge boxes. Counts can briefly go negative when a sensor double-fires on exit; the ingest job clamps these to zero and flags the interval. If the feed stalls for more than five minutes, the dashboard falls back to the last known snapshot. Sensor mappings, queue names, and the replay procedure are documented on the internal page below.

runbook for tahog-kadug: https://gitlab.qirvanworks.corp/projects/pages/view/b139298aed28

Checklist item 14: Cold storage bucket archiving. Before closing the quarterly audit, confirm that every bucket in the Frostvale tier flagged inactive for 180+ days has been moved to the Glacierline archive class. Verify the retention manifest matches the archive index, and note any buckets excluded with a written justification. New team members should double-check checksums after transfer, not just object counts. When all steps are complete, obtain sign-off from the archive owner.

named custodian: Oliath Ralax